The Metropolitan Police Service (MPS), formerly and still commonly the Metropolitan Police, and also formerly semi-formally called the Metropolitan Police Force, and informally referred to as the Met Police, is the territorial police force responsible for law enforcement in Greater London, excluding the square mile of the City of London, which is the responsibility of the City of London Police.

Saturday, January 13, 2024

ISSUE: S. To reduce shoplifting offences in St Johns Wood High Street.
M. Review PLANWEB and METINSIGHTS to establish offending times and MO's in order to create action plan against offenders. Working on project to supply St. John's Wood High Street with CCTV.
A. Patrols in affected areas to apprehend known suspects and to deter potential offenders.
R. A growing concern that suspects started to make threats to staff at shops.
T. reviewed 6 weekly between panel meetings and/or when the crime is committed.''
ACTION: Regular patrols and liaison with local business contributed to the substantive reduction in crime in St. John's Wood High Street. I also finally closed the project of CCTV installation with two cameras supplied and fitted.
